Find the square root of 1764 using prime factorization with explanation and solution.

Answer:

42

Step-by-step explanation:

The product of the prime factors of 1764 is

1764 = 2² × 3² × 7² , thus

[tex]\sqrt{1764}[/tex]

= [tex]\sqrt{2^{2}(3^{2} )(7^{2} ) }[/tex]

= [tex]\sqrt{2^{2} }[/tex] × [tex]\sqrt{3^{2} }[/tex] × [tex]\sqrt{7^{2} }[/tex]

= 2 × 3 × 7

= 42
